1 d

Presto string contains example?

Presto string contains example?

For Java use this: ^*$. If a key is found in multiple input maps, that key's value in the resulting map comes from an arbitrary input map. 38. Example 2: Following example illustrates how the user can print the desired result instead of a boolean output: Output: Explanation: In the above example, we take a sub-string as 'input' and the main string as 'str'. Here is a simple example of SQL function for COSECANT: presto>CREATE OR REPLACE FUNCTION ahanacosec(x double) RETURNS double COMMENT 'Cosecant trigonometric function' LANGUAGE SQL. StartsWith gets translated as (string LIKE pattern + "%" AND CHARINDEX (pattern, string) = 1) OR pattern = '' where. When necessary, values can be explicitly cast to a. Concatenates the elements of the given array using the delimiter and an optional string to replace nulls. Business Analytics Certification; Java & Spring Boot Advanced Certification; Data Science Advanced Certification; Advanced Certification In Cloud Computing And DevOps List contains () method in Java with Examples. In these examples \2603 and #2603 represent a snowman character. This will have more value as it will also give the number of occurrences. Feb 3, 2021 · Is it possible to use a comma separated string for an IN query? I would like to execute the following query using the string a,b,c. size must not be negative and padstring must be non-empty. WHEN condition THEN result [ ELSE result ] END. Let's see an example. contains (substring) searches a specified substring in the current string. For a Presto database, the URL has the following format: The Elasticsearch connector provides additional security options to support Elasticsearch clusters that have been configured to use TLS. functx:contains-case-insensitive. Splits string on delimiter and returns the field index. The semantics of this function are broken. The IN operator returns TRUE if the value matches any of the literal values in the list. You can use one of the array-processing functions to select the relevant rows. I also want to avoid a 12 line CASE WHEN statement to parse the month if possible presto JDBC Driver. The WITH clause defines named relations for use within a query. Learn more Explore Teams Mar 13, 2018 · I need a to search which rows contains the array [3,4,5] in the correct order. Long Unicode codes with 6 digits require a plus symbol + before the code. Explicitly cast a value as a type. In order to use it, you need to import the package and use the database/sql API then. SELECT array_agg(message) as sequence from mytable group by id which produces a table that looks like this: sequence 1 foo foo bar baz bar baz 2 foo bar bar bar baz 3 foo foo foo bar bar baz When % is used on both sides of the substring, we match any sequence of characters before and after example. Gauges: Medium, Light and Ultralight. Returns a map containing the count of the number of times each input value occurs. strpos (string, substring, instance) -> bigint() Returns the position of the N-th instance of substring in string. WHEN value THEN result [ ELSE result ] END. But I want to know what are possible keys and then apply group by and other operations based on those keys. One example of a cause-and-effect sentence is, “Because he studied more than usual for the test, Bob scored higher than he had on previous exams. Learn to check if a string contains the specified substring in Java using the String String. The last element in the array always contain everything left in the string. Map Aggregate Functions. Splits string on delimiter and returns an array of size at most limit. Contains () function returns boolean value, it returns true in both the cases. Returns element of array at given index. For this first example, you want to match a string in which the first character is an "s" or "p" and the second character is a vowel. functx:index-of-string-first. String Functions These functions assume that the input strings contain valid UTF-8 encoded Unicode code points. Extract the list using JSON EXTRACT; Cast the list as an array of jsons Your source data often contains arrays with complex data types and nested structures. Returns a map containing the count of the number of times each input value occurs. This method is a powerful way to join multiple datasets and can be used to find patterns and insights in your data. Description. Returns true if an input contains a given value, false if not. It should contain a single JSON item. Although PowerPoint does not import images directly from the Web, you can transfer them to your prese. Long Unicode codes with 6 digits require a plus symbol + before the code. I am trying to test whether a string (varchar) has only digit characters (0-9). ROW enables you to cleanly map JSON keys to types as follows: ROW(name VARCHAR, powers ARRAY(VARCHAR), id INTEGER)) Note how the names in each. Provide details and share your research! But avoid …. Note that the machine running the framework and tests does not have to be the same as the machine or set of machines running your SQL on Hadoop database. If JSON is valid ( you can easily fix it in a subquery ), extract data, cast it to array (row) and get values using CASE expressions. Last updated on Jan 26, 2023. The last element in the array always contain everything left in the string. Determine if value exists in json. containsIgnoreCase(container, content); // I used to write like this in java Plugin¶. This post is a lot different from our earlier entries. Note that the string we passed to the. In this Asp. It allows flattening nested queries or simplifying subqueries. For example, the following query casts the value of the `col1` column to a string: SELECT cast(col1 as string) FROM table. Learn more Explore Teams I need a to search which rows contains the array [3,4,5] in the correct order. split (string, delimiter, limit) Splits string on delimiter and returns an array of size at most limit. The major hotel programs have done a lot to keep cu. If your pantry is a mess, you’re not alone. The IN operator returns TRUE if the value matches any of the literal values in the list. Tutorials Point is a leading Ed Tech company striving to provide the best. Top Certifications. I tried to find the resolution in the Presto documentation, but with no success Evaluates the JSONPath-like expression json_path on json (a string containing JSON) and returns the result as a JSON string: SELECT json_extract ( json , '$book' ); json_extract_scalar ( json , json_path ) → varchar Decodes binary data from the base64 encoded string using the URL safe alphabet. Like cast(), but returns null if the cast fails. How to search for all except certain strings using like (or different solution welcomed)? 10. Set by response header X-Presto-Started-Transaction-Id and cleared by X-Presto-Clear-Transaction-Id. SELECT * FROM table1 JOIN table2 ON parse_datetime (table1. PowerPoint can move elements, emphasize objects already on the screen or cause new ones to. I am new to writing sql queries in presto and was looking for a function similar to 'starts_with'. I need to keep 5 symbols from the right side of the string. It uses indexOf() method to check if this string contains the argument string or not. regexp_replace(string, pattern, replacement) → varchar Conversion Functions. This is the base query, you can take it from here if you like. Returns a map containing the count of the number of times each input value occurs. Your example has one but it is removed from the. For example:. You can use SUBSTR to substring a column value. ROW maps objects to SQL column types. NOTE that the index position of the first character is 1 (not zero), the same as in standard SQL. lewiston tribune death notices A Hive view statement that contains functions undefined in Presto is inaccessible. from_base32(string)-> varbinary ¶ Decodes binary data from the base32 encoded string. See below for a case-sensitive formula. In order to use the Thrift connector with an external system, you need to implement the PrestoThriftService interface, found below. X-Presto-Client-Tags. From looking at other resources, it seems I should be casting the "ids" element into a map and then array, and unnest eventually. Removes every instance of the substring matched by the regular expression pattern from string. name = 'Alice') Note that the answer involving CROSS JOIN and UNNEST only works if each array contains a single user. When you use CREATE_TABLE, Athena defines a STRUCT in it, populates it with data, and creates the ROW data type for you, for each row in the dataset. IndexOf(string) is to use the current culture, while the default for string. This function is similar to the LIKE operator, except that the pattern only needs to be contained within string, rather than needing to match all of string. Removes trailing whitespace from string. Sometimes the apron strings can be tied a little too tightly. There is no canonical string representation for a MAP in Presto/Trino, so so there's no way to cast it directly to MAP(VARCHAR, VARCHAR). regexp_replace(string, pattern) → varchar. Behaviors of the casts are shown with the examples below: Example 3: C# String Contains () Ignore Case. www securetech net inmate to_base32(binary)-> varchar ¶ Encodes binary into a base32 string representation. The equi-join concatenates tables by comparing join keys using the equal (=) operator. The next release of Presto (version 312) will include a new optimization to remove unnecessary casts which might have been added implicitly by the query planner or explicitly by users when they wrote the query. Concatenated_String This is a test. For this first example, you want to match a string in which the first character is an "s" or "p" and the second character is a vowel. To remove only the leading or trailing spaces, use the LTRIM or RTRIM function respectively, as LTRIM ( string) or RTRIM ( string ). The semantics of this function are broken. edited Jun 15, 2018 at 18:32. May 23, 2023 · Implementation of contains () method. Splits string on delimiter and returns an array. date_str, 'yyyy-MM-dd') = table2 Description: Shows how to perform a join operation based. However, I am having some trouble doing this as the "ids" element is nested within a nested element. To remove only the leading or trailing spaces, use the LTRIM or RTRIM function respectively, as LTRIM ( string) or RTRIM ( string ). If the argument is null then NullPointerException will be thrown. This is a basic example of how to connect to Presto from Python using PyHive. SELECT n + 1 FROM t WHERE n < 4 defines the recursion step relation. xfinity outage map springfield ma Winding nylon string around a spool by hand is too time-consuming. For example, the following query casts the value of the `col1` column to a string: SELECT cast (col1 as string) FROM table. presto-jdbc288. 11. Returns the number of occurrences of the pattern in the string. There are no explicit checks for valid UTF-8 and the functions may return incorrect results on invalid UTF-8. from_base32(string)-> varbinary ¶ Decodes binary data from the base32 encoded string. Supports case and diacritic options0. UNNEST( JSON_EXTRACT(message,'$. For example, the following queries are equivalent: … String Functions. 00' NOT LIKE '% [^0-9 THEN 'Valid' ELSE 'Invalid' END. Top Certifications. regexp_find(string, pattern) → integer returns the. If both c and i are included in the parameters string, the one that occurs last in the string dictates whether the function performs case-sensitive or case-insensitive matching. If no match is found, the result from the ELSE clause is returned if it exists, otherwise null is returned. Jan 19, 2024 · Description: Converts a string to date format considering a different locale in Presto using the from_iso8601_timestamp function. split(string, delimiter, limit) → array<varchar>. For a list of the time zones that can that you want to convert into another data type. Contains () function returns boolean value, it returns true in both the cases. This will have more value as it will also give the number of occurrences.

Post Opinion